首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动态下拉菜单的Vue.js - created()

动态下拉菜单是一种常见的前端交互组件,它可以根据用户的操作动态地加载选项列表。Vue.js是一种流行的JavaScript框架,可以用于构建用户界面。在Vue.js中,created()是一个生命周期钩子函数,它会在Vue实例被创建后立即调用。

在动态下拉菜单的实现中,可以利用Vue.js的created()钩子函数来初始化下拉菜单的选项列表。具体步骤如下:

  1. 在Vue组件中,定义一个data属性,用于存储下拉菜单的选项列表数据。
代码语言:txt
复制
data() {
  return {
    options: []  // 下拉菜单选项列表数据
  }
}
  1. 在created()钩子函数中,通过异步请求或其他方式获取下拉菜单的选项数据,并将数据赋值给options属性。
代码语言:txt
复制
created() {
  // 异步请求获取下拉菜单选项数据
  axios.get('/api/options')
    .then(response => {
      this.options = response.data;  // 将获取到的数据赋值给options属性
    })
    .catch(error => {
      console.error(error);
    });
}
  1. 在Vue组件的模板中,使用v-for指令遍历options数组,动态生成下拉菜单的选项。
代码语言:txt
复制
<select>
  <option v-for="option in options" :value="option.value">{{ option.label }}</option>
</select>

在实际应用中,动态下拉菜单可以应用于各种场景,例如表单中的选择框、搜索框的自动补全等。对于腾讯云相关产品,可以使用腾讯云提供的云开发服务和云函数来实现动态下拉菜单的数据获取和处理。具体推荐的腾讯云产品和产品介绍链接如下:

  1. 云开发:腾讯云提供的一站式后端云服务,可用于快速构建小程序、网站和移动应用。了解更多:云开发产品介绍
  2. 云函数:腾讯云提供的无服务器函数计算服务,可用于编写和运行动态下拉菜单的后端逻辑代码。了解更多:云函数产品介绍

通过使用腾讯云的云开发和云函数,可以实现动态下拉菜单的数据获取和处理,并提供稳定可靠的云计算服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Excel: 设置动态二级下拉菜单

本文要讲述是如何通过offset、match和counta函数,得到动态二级下拉菜单。...基于给定参数表(参数表内数据后期可以动态增加),下面就来介绍一级菜单和二级菜单设置。 2 一级菜单设置 (1) 定义单元格名称 省份:OFFSET(参数表!...A:A)-1,1) 通过函数offset产生动态一级下拉菜单,好处是后期如果要添加新省份名称,那么单元格名称省份内容也会动态更新。...注意:Counter中1000只是随意设置大数,是为了确保能够满足动态添加需要。如果数据源输入内容是Counter,则下拉菜单中会出现很多空白项。...参考资料: [1] 求助动态二级下拉菜单制作(https://club.excelhome.net/thread-1620256-1-1.html) [2] OFFSET 函数(https://support.microsoft.com

4.8K10
  • 使用 Spring Boot 从数据库实现动态下拉菜单

    使用 Spring Boot 从数据库实现动态下拉菜单 动态下拉菜单(或依赖下拉菜单概念对于编码来说是令人兴奋且具有挑战性动态下拉列表意味着一个下拉列表中值取决于前一个下拉列表中选择值。...一个简单示例是三个下拉框,显示区、taluk 和村庄名称,其中 taluk 中值取决于区中选择值,村庄中值取决于 taluk 下拉列表中选择值。...动态下拉可以使用以下技术来实现: 任何数据库都可用于加载要在下拉列表中填充地区、塔鲁克和村庄详细信息。在本例中,我们将使用 PostgreSQL。...随后操作和命令与前面的方法类似,除了一些细微变化之外,这些变化在下面给出子点中进行了解释: 检索 taluk 名称以及相应地区代码和 taluk 代码查询是select * from taluk...该网页很简单,只有基本布局,没有太多 CSS,因为本教程范围只是解释基于数据库动态下拉列表。现在下拉菜单网页布局已经编码,是时候编写 AJAX 调用了。

    1K50

    使用 SVG 和 Vue.Js 构建动态树图

    本文将会带你了解到我是如何创建一个动态树图,该图使用 SVG(可缩放矢量图形)绘制三次贝塞尔曲线(Cubic Bezier)路径并通过 Vue.js 以实现数据响应。...基于 SVG 和 Vue.js 框架强大功能,我们可以轻松创建基于数据驱动、可交互和可配置图表与信息图。...= (x2,50%size) x3,y3 —— 最后一对锚点,指示路径绘制结束位置。这里, x3 模仿 x2 值,这是动态计算。 y3 占据了 size 80%。...让我们将所有的值都放入图表中,以帮助我们看到完整图像。 ? 使用 Vue.js 动态 SVG 到目前为止,我们已经了解了贝塞尔曲线本质,以及它工作原理。因此,我们有了静态 SVG 图概念。...使用 Vue.js 和 SVG,我们现在将用数据驱动图表,并将其从静态转换为动态。 在本节中,我们将把 SVG 图分解为 Vue 组件,并将 SVG 属性绑定到计算属性,并使其响应数据更改。

    6.5K50

    html导航栏可以展开下拉菜单,html导航栏下拉菜单如何制作

    html导航栏菜单实例解析: html导航栏菜单HTML部分: 我们可以使用任何HTML元素来打开下拉菜单,如:,或a元素。...使用容器元素(如: )来创建下拉菜单内容,并放在任何你想放位置上。 使用 元素来包裹这些元素,并使用CSS来设置下拉内容样式。....dropdown-content类中是实际下拉菜单。默认是隐藏,在鼠标移动到指定元素后会显示。 注意min-width值设置为160px。你可以随意修改它。...看,这就是代码效果,有导航栏下拉列表,隐身导航栏,鼠标移上去才有反应。 这就是导航栏下拉菜单简单制作,有问题可以在下方留言。...看完了这篇文章,相信你对html导航栏下拉菜单如何制作有了一定了解,想了解更多相关知识,欢迎关注亿速云行业资讯频道,感谢各位阅读!

    8.7K20

    Vue.js 中通过计算属性动态设置属性值

    引子 前面我们已经陆续介绍了 Vue.js 框架常用基本语法,现在,我们可以结合这些语法实现一个小功能:展示一个 Web 框架列表,并支持新增框架。...="UTF-8"> 计算属性示例代码 <script src="https://cdn.jsdelivr.net/npm/vue@2.5.21/dist/<em>vue.js</em>...、列表渲染、事件监听和处理、属性和类名绑定等所有基本语法,在浏览器中预览该页面: 我们可以通过列表下面的输入框和按钮新增框架到列表项: 可以看到,使用 <em>Vue.js</em> 框架<em>的</em>开发效率比传统 JavaScript...,列表项并没有按照 language 排序,为了更优雅<em>的</em>实现这个排序,可以使用 <em>Vue.js</em> 框架提供<em>的</em>计算属性功能。...好了关于 <em>Vue.js</em> <em>的</em>基本语法学院君就简单介绍到这里,下篇教程,我们将开启 Vue 组件开发之旅。

    12.7K50

    android studio 下拉菜单Spinner使用详解

    :设置列表框背景 android:prompt:设置对话框模式列表框提示信息(标题),只能够引用string.xml 中资源id,而不能直接写字符串 android:spinnerMode:列表框模式...,有两个可选值: dialog:对话框风格窗口 dropdown:下拉菜单风格窗口(默认) 可选属性:android:entries:使用数组资源设置下拉列表框列表项目 如果开发者使用Spinner...时己经可以确定列表选择框里列表项,则完全不需要编写代码,只要为Spinner指定android:entries属性即可让Spinner正常工作;如果程序需要在运行时动态 地决定Spinner列表项,...它们之间区别在于,Spinner显示是一个垂直列表选择框,而Gallery显示是一个水平列表选择框。...Gallery本身用法非常简单——基本上与Spinner用法相似,只要为它提供一个内容 Adapter即可,该AdaptergetView()方法所返回View将作为Gallery列表列表项。

    6.4K21
    领券